Revert "Fix nested namespaces in google-readability-nested-namespace-comments."
This reverts r315057. The revision introduces assertion failures: assertion failed at llvm/tools/clang/include/clang/Basic/SourceManager.h:428 in const clang::SrcMgr::ExpansionInfo &clang::SrcMgr::SLocEntry::getExpansion() const: isExpansion() && "Not a macro expansion SLocEntry!"
